Canterbury pilgrimage : the first hundred years of the Church of England in Canterbury, New Zealand / by Stephen Parr.

By: Contributor(s): Publication details: Christchurch [N.Z.] : Centennial Committee of the Diocese of Christchurch, 1951.Description: 203 p., [10] leaves of plates : ill., maps ; 22 cmSubject(s): Summary: This book tells the story of the history of the Church of England in Canterbury, and of the province itself. It traces the development of church life from its brave and optimistic beginnings, records early disappointments and successes and the steady progress which changed a barren scene into a strong and flourishing diocese.
